Dispatch: EFG 2024 and a peek at the future of CSR

Sam and Madi reflect on this year’s EFG conference and share what they learned about the future of CSR.
Listen on:

This episode is a quick conversation between Sam and Madi on their takeaways from EFG 2024, held in Minneapolis last month.

In this episode we cover:

  • The increasing politicization of DEI and CSR programs
  • Areas where ideas like trust-based philanthropy are making progress
  • Ways AI both did and didn’t fit in the conversation

Sam Caplan

Sam Caplan is the Vice President of Social Impact at Submittable, a platform that foundations, governments, nonprofits, and other changemakers use to launch, manage, and measure impactful granting and CSR programs. Inspired by the amazing work performed by practitioners of all stripes, Sam strives to help them achieve their missions through better, more effective software.

Sam formerly served as founder of New Spark Strategy, Chief Information Officer at the Walton Family Foundation, and head of technology at the Walmart Foundation. He consults, advises, and writes on social impact technology, strategy, and innovation.
